How are brake pads worn on a Mini Cooper?
The 2010 brake pad warning uses wear sensors placed on the left front and right rear wheels that are basically loops of wire embedded in the sensor which are held at a certain distance off from the brake pad backing plate. As the brake pads wear, the sensor wears away from the abrasion from the brake rotor, until the loop of wire is broken.

How to reset the brake pads on a Mini Cooper?
Here are the procedures for performing the reset. 1) Turn ignition key to position-2 (ignition on, without starting engine) for 30 seconds. 2) Turn key off, then back on. Warning should be reset. The MINI has a brake pad wear sensor on the left-front and the right-rear brake pads.

How does the brake wear sensor work on a Mini Cooper?
When the Brake Wear Service indicator illuminates, one of the two Brake Wear Warning Sensors has been triggered. The brake wear sensor is a wire loop that gets worn down against the rotor. Once the wire is worn thru and the circuit is opened, the brake wear indicator is illuminated.
